⢠Introduction to Water Treatment Innovations: Overview of traditional water treatment methods and the growing importance of nanotechnology in water treatment.
⢠Fundamentals of Nanotechnology: Basics of nanotechnology, nanomaterials, and their unique properties that enable advanced water treatment solutions.
⢠Nanomaterials for Water Treatment: Detailed exploration of nanomaterials, including nanoadsorbents, nanometals, and nanocomposites, used in water treatment processes.
⢠Nanofiltration and Membrane Technologies: Principles, advantages, and limitations of nanofiltration and other membrane-based technologies for water treatment.
⢠Photocatalytic Water Treatment: The role of nanophotocatalysts in the degradation of organic pollutants and disinfection of water.
⢠Nanotechnology for Desalination: Emerging nanotech-based desalination methods, including nanocoatings, nanoporous membranes, and nanostructured materials.
⢠Sensors and Monitoring Systems: The use of nanotechnology in developing advanced sensors for detecting contaminants and monitoring water quality.
⢠Challenges and Future Prospects: Overview of the current challenges in implementing nanotech-based water treatment solutions and future research directions.
⢠Environmental, Health, and Safety Implications: Examination of the potential environmental, health, and safety risks associated with nanotechnology in water treatment.
⢠Regulations and Standards: Analysis of existing regulations and standards governing the use of nanotechnology in water treatment and potential policy implications.
